Frequently Asked Questions

We provide childcare and early education programs for children 6 weeks to 12 years old.

Yes, our school is state-licensed and regularly inspected to ensure we meet or exceed state standards, including child-to-teacher ratios, staff background checks, safety, and security.

We are closed the following days each year: New Year’s Day, Martin Luther King Jr. Day, Memorial Day, Independence Day, Labor Day, Thanksgiving Day, the day after Thanksgiving, and Christmas Day. If one of these days falls on a weekend, it will be observed on either Friday or Monday. In addition, we close one day each year for professional development.

We utilize the award-winning Creative Curriculum® in our classrooms, blended with a focus on STEAM. Creative Curriculum® is one of the few curriculums approved by every State Department of Education in the country.

Yes, all classrooms and playgrounds are equipped with security cameras. Families can view the live feed anytime from our lobby or director’s office.

Yes, we serve nutritious and nourishing meals daily, including breakfast, lunch, and an afternoon snack -- all planned by a licensed nutritionist. Vegetarian options are always available, and meals are included in tuition at no extra cost.

We take food allergies and dietary restrictions seriously. If your child has specific nutritional needs, please let us know, and we’ll work with your family to create a safe and suitable meal plan. 

Yes! We have an open-door policy, and you are welcome to visit any time. You are also encouraged to volunteer in your child’s classroom. You can act as a guest reader, attend field trips and activities, assist with special events, and more. If you’re interested in learning more, please contact your Director.

With the MyFoundations app, you’ll receive photos and videos of your child, updates on diapering, naps, meals, daily reports, and more.

Our tuition is carefully determined by a variety of factors, including location, child’s age, and scheduling needs. Please contact us for tuition rate options that meet your family’s needs.
